Agrihealth Calving Ropes
The Agrihealth Calving Ropes are designed to provide reliable assistance during difficult calvings, helping to support a safer and more controlled delivery for both cow and calf.
Featuring two easy-slip loops, these durable manual calving ropes allow secure attachment to the calf’s legs, providing improved grip and controlled pulling force when assistance is required.
Supplied as a pair, they are a practical addition to any calving kit, livestock first aid box or farm essentials range.
